What is Microsoft Access?
Microsoft Access, a database management system, comes with the combination of the ACE or Access Database Engine with a functional graphical user interface. Microsoft Access is a member of 365 suite applications and developed for the business house to manage enormous data for analysis, control, and work with them.
In 1992, Microsoft introduced its first version. Users have had a great experience since its launch. Over time, Microsoft developers have upgraded the Access and made it better to produce smoother results.

Types of Databases You Can Store in MS Access
Despite the volume of your business or clients, you can store two types of databases. They're -
Flat File Database - In this format, you need to store the data in a plain text file and cannot create multiple tables.
Relational Database - In this form, the database is stored so that it relates to one another. Further, the organization of the data supports each other in the form of rows and columns.
What Are the Components of MS Access?
Managing accounts is the main component of MS Access. It's a primary accounting database that helps keep invoices and bills up-to-date, manage budgets, credit and debit transactions, etc. If you're dealing with multiple transactions of large amounts, you need to store all these data systems so that you can count every penny your company uses. Access is like an account book of your household, but here the volume is significant, and you'll get a graphical user interface.
Let's move to its components and discuss them briefly.
Tables - Tables created in the Access in the form of rows and columns. You need to enter the exact data to extract the perfect calculation. The table's appearance is similar to the Google Spreadsheet Or Excel sheet that includes column headings and titles.
Queries - The user is looking for a calculation or output after preparing the table. It is called Queries. Through Queries, you can filter measures, sort out the pending information, update new data, etc.
Macros - Macros is used to make the report. It enables automating multiple tasks and to avail the accurate report.
Relationship - If you add more than one table, it creates a relationship between the tables. It follows the relationship orders like one to one, one to many, and many to many.
Forms - Forms are a user interface component for a database application. You can use the Forms classified into bound and unbound forms.
Report - The report provides the information you've entered after analyzing or reviewing the database. Later you can customize or modify the report as per your requirement
Module - A module is a pre-defined instruction created by the programmer in the database. You can utilize the module and manage and control your database.
Key Benefits of Microsoft Access
Let's look into some of the key benefits of Microsoft Access -
Easy to install
MS Access takes minimum time to install on your PC. Once the installation is done, you can use its complete functional database with the Wizard guide. Even if you're not a technical person, you can still use the application effortlessly and utilize its benefits.
Simple integration
The integration is simple, and within a few clicks, you can integrate it with your Windows system and another office suite.
Manage massive data
You can analyze an extensive database. It allows you to manage 2GB of data, including database objects.
Compatible with SQL
It offers a graphical interface that is compatible with SQL. Further, you can use its SQL statement in Macros and Visual Basic for Application (VBA).
Easy data sharing
Access offers a multi-user feature to enable the data-sharing option for up to 40 people simultaneously. They can further edit or modify the entries with whom you share the data. The latest version of Access allows you to create a web application to make the necessary changes using a web browser.
Automate function
The program lets you automate functions with Macros. It also enables summarizing the data report in digital or printed form.
Various templates and wizards
Microsoft offers various readymade templates within the program. If you want more, you can download it from the Microsoft website. These templates and wizards allow users to work with pre-defined tables, queries, forms, macros, and reports.
Easy import & export
MS Access offers tools under the External Data menu tab that allows you to import various data from several sources. For example, if you have many data sources like Word, Excel, Web browser, etc., you can import them. Further, its External Data tab allows you to export data from Access with different formats.
Simple user interface
Access's attractive graphical interface gives users satisfaction. Its simple function allows you to create, manage, analyze the data and prepare reports.
Cost effective
MS Access is a much cheaper database management system than Oracle or SQL servers.
